Davie United Soccer Club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 68,693 | 69,471 | −778 | 0.1 | — |
| 2012 | 206,981 | 207,111 | −130 | 0.0 | 20% |
| 2013 | 234,567 | 216,420 | 18,147 | 1.0 | 18% |
| 2014 | 315,970 | 323,769 | −7,799 | 0.4 | 13% |
| 2015 | 428,755 | 402,826 | 25,929 | 1.1 | 15% |
| 2016 | 645,412 | 671,108 | −25,696 | 0.2 | 14% |
| 2017 | 801,152 | 675,602 | 125,550 | 2.4 | 7% |
| 2018 | 573,617 | 611,498 | −37,881 | 1.9 | 0% |
| 2019 | 701,028 | 666,350 | 34,678 | 2.4 | 0% |
| 2020 | 667,962 | 725,150 | −57,188 | 1.3 | 0% |
| 2021 | 674,234 | 626,787 | 47,447 | 0.0 | 0% |
| 2022 | 1,009,321 | 917,696 | 91,625 | 2.8 | 0% |
| 2023 | 1,217,391 | 1,058,214 | 159,177 | 4.2 | 0% |
| 2024 | 1,611,954 | 1,414,496 | 197,458 | 4.9 | 0% |
In its most recent public year (2024), this organization brought in $197,458 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 4.9 months of spending, up from 0.1 in 2011. Staff pay was 0% of spending.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2024.
